HUNT FOR RED OCTOPI
The Red Wings' 800-pound octopus mascot wasn't the only cephalopod to hit the Joe Louis Arena ice during Game 2 of the Stanley Cup finals. Per fan custom since 1952, at least one real mollusk was thrown onto the rink during the game, which Detroit won 3-0.
WIZARDRY OF OZ
A furious, last-second rush by the desperate Penguins and Marian Hossa (18) didn't allow goalie Chris Osgood to rest in crease in Game 6. Osgood, who allowed just 30 goals in 18 playoff starts, stopped this chance with no time left in Detroit's Cup-clinching 3-2 win.
CUP, CUP AND AWAY
Nicklas Lidstrom was the first Red Wing to hoist the hardware after Detroit edged Pittsburgh in Game 6 to win the franchise's 11th Stanley Cup. Lidstrom, who won his fourth title in five finals, became the only European-born captain of a Stanley Cup champion.
